How Does TVB Company Work?

Television Broadcasts Limited (TVB) is a major media player in Hong Kong, operating since 1965. In 2024, its terrestrial TV channels held a significant 79% market share in Hong Kong. TVB reaches over 2.41 million households with news, entertainment, and information.

How Does TVB Company Work?

TVB is a fully integrated media company involved in creating, broadcasting, and distributing content globally. Its operations encompass dramas, variety shows, and current affairs, alongside artist management and program licensing.

What Are the Key Operations Driving TVB’s Success?

The TVB company operates on a vertically integrated model, covering content creation, broadcasting, and distribution, positioning it as a major producer of Chinese programs globally. Its core value proposition is delivering a diverse array of news, entertainment, and informational content through its free-to-air channels in Hong Kong, including TVB Jade and TVB Pearl, which are accessible 24/7 to millions of homes. In the fourth quarter of 2024, TVB's channels captured an impressive 81% of the total viewership across all Hong Kong television channels.

Icon Core Operations: Content Production and Broadcasting

TVB's operational framework is deeply rooted in extensive content production, encompassing dramas, variety shows, and current affairs. The company actively participates in co-producing dramas, notably with mainland Chinese video platforms like Youku and Tencent Video, which contributed to a 69% revenue growth in 2024 due to increased collaborative efforts.

Icon Talent Management and Production Capacity

The company manages a significant talent pool of approximately 3,500 staff, including over 500 artistes. This robust workforce underpins TVB's strong production capabilities and its ability to generate a wide variety of high-quality content.

Icon Distribution Networks: Traditional and Digital Reach

TVB's distribution extends beyond traditional broadcasting to embrace digital platforms. Its Hong Kong-based streaming service, myTV SUPER, generates revenue from both advertising and subscriptions, with premium service pack subscribers reaching 204,412 as of December 31, 2024, marking a 6% increase.

Icon Global Content Licensing and Digital Footprint

The company also reaches global Chinese audiences through content licensing agreements with pay TV platforms in regions such as Malaysia, Singapore, the USA, Canada, and Vietnam. Furthermore, TVB maintains a substantial digital media presence, with over 23 million average monthly active users across its Hong Kong digital assets in 2024, an 81% surge from the previous year.

Icon

Mainland China Digital Strategy and Audience Engagement

In mainland China, TVB operates a direct-to-consumer digital media business under the Mai Dui Dui brand and a multi-channel network (MCN) through social media platforms like Douyin and Kuaishou. This strategy has garnered significant reach, with TVB-related accounts accumulating 181 million followers in mainland China.

How Does TVB Make Money?

The TVB company's primary revenue streams are built upon advertising from its broadcast channels and the sale of its produced content. In 2024, the company reported a total Group revenue of HK$3,258 million, a slight 2% dip from HK$3,323 million in 2023, though its core TV-related businesses saw a healthy 10% increase to HK$3,131 million.

Icon

Advertising Revenue Growth

The Hong Kong TV Broadcasting segment experienced significant growth, with advertiser income rising by 14% to HK$1,464 million in 2024. TVB's market share of total TV ad spending in Hong Kong expanded from 75% in 2023 to 83% in 2024.

Icon

Digital Advertising Surge

Digital advertising on its myTV SUPER streaming service demonstrated robust performance, achieving a 30% growth in 2024. This indicates a successful expansion into digital monetization strategies.

Icon

Mainland China Operations Expansion

The Mainland China Operations segment saw a 17% revenue increase in 2024. This growth was primarily fueled by a substantial 69% surge in its drama co-production business through strategic alliances.

Icon

Content Sales and Licensing

Revenue from Mainland China also includes program licensing and video streaming. The company's Multi-Channel Network (MCN) business achieved over RMB$570 million in gross merchandise volume (GMV) in 2023 through livestream e-commerce.

Icon

E-Commerce Segment Restructuring

The e-Commerce business segment experienced a revenue decline of 44% to HK$486 million in 2023 due to a challenging retail market. The company is focusing on higher-margin products and has merged its Ztore platform with Neigbuy.

Icon

Diversified Income Streams

Additional revenue sources for the TVB company include artist management, music royalties, and licensing income for short-form videos. These diversified streams contribute to the overall financial health of the business.

Icon

Future Revenue Outlook

Looking ahead to 2025, the company anticipates continued growth in advertising income, with pre-commitments for advertising packages already showing a double-digit percentage increase compared to the previous year. Furthermore, starting in January 2025, TVB began offering advertising on its TVB Jade and Pearl channel broadcast feeds to Guangdong province, aiming to capitalize on the Greater Bay Area market.

Which Strategic Decisions Have Shaped TVB’s Business Model?

TVB has strategically adjusted its operations to align with evolving media consumption and market demands. These moves reflect a commitment to efficiency and sustained market presence in the competitive broadcasting landscape.

Icon Operational Streamlining

In 2024, TVB consolidated its terrestrial channels from five to four, merging J2 and TVB Finance, Sports & Information into 'TVB Plus'. This move is projected to save approximately HK$100 million annually in costs.

Icon Cost Optimization Efforts

Total operating costs saw a reduction of HK$565 million, or 15%, in 2024 compared to 2023, reaching HK$3,279 million. This was achieved through content production efficiencies and overhead reductions.

Icon Financial Restructuring

The company undertook significant write-downs of legacy and non-performing assets in 2024, reducing its loss attributable to equity holders by HK$272 million to HK$491 million.

Icon Strategic Partnerships and Growth

Expanded co-production agreements with mainland platforms like Youku and Tencent Video led to a 69% increase in co-production revenue in 2024, highlighting a key growth area.

How Is TVB Positioning Itself for Continued Success?

TVB company operations demonstrate a strong hold on Hong Kong's broadcasting landscape, complemented by a growing digital presence. The TVB business model leverages its dominant viewership to secure significant advertising revenue, while also exploring international content licensing.

Icon Industry Position: Dominant Broadcaster

TVB commands a significant share of Hong Kong's broadcasting sector. In 2024, its terrestrial TV channels captured 79% of viewership, translating to an 83% share of total TV ad spending. The company also leads in digital media, with over 23 million average monthly active users across its Hong Kong digital assets in 2024.

Icon Risks and Headwinds: Market Volatility and Competition

Despite its strong position, TVB faces risks from economic fluctuations impacting the advertising market and competition from new media platforms. Changing consumer preferences towards digital content have also led to a slight revenue decline in its streaming services, and its e-Commerce segment experienced a notable revenue drop in 2023.

Icon Future Outlook: Growth and Digital Expansion

TVB anticipates substantial EBITDA growth and a positive net profit for 2025, following asset write-downs in 2024. Strategic initiatives include expanding advertising income, particularly in the Greater Bay Area, and driving growth through drama co-productions in Mainland China.

Icon Strategic Initiatives: Digital Transformation and AI Integration

The company is focused on expanding its digital media footprint and revenue streams, including initiatives like 'TV 3.0' to enhance ad-supported viewership on myTV SUPER. TVB is also integrating artificial intelligence into its creative and production processes to improve efficiency and content delivery.
